Strategizing Your Cyber Security Budget

Budget considerations are essential when selecting the right cyber security service in London. Given the critical nature of the services provided, it is important to align your investment with the protection your infrastructure requires. Here are some recommended approaches:

SMEs and Startups

For SMEs or startups, it’s advisable to engage in services that offer essential protection without overextending budgets. Services like penetration testing, incident response, and basic compliance management can range from £3,000 to £10,000 annually depending on the depth and frequency of the services.

Established Businesses

Organizations with more complex networks and greater exposure to cyber threats should consider comprehensive security programs that include advanced threat detection, forensic services, and in-depth security management protocols. These could cost between £20,000 and £100,000 annually but represent a scalable investment tailored to specific threat profiles and regulatory requirements.

Advice for Budget Allocation

1. Plan Ahead: Develop a multi-year cybersecurity strategy, allowing for better financial planning and alignment with long-term business goals.

2. Assess Regularly: Continuously review and adjust your cybersecurity needs as your company grows and new threats emerge. This dynamic assessment helps ensure that spending remains both effective and efficient.

3. Quality Over Cost: Opt for quality services which can offer more meaningful long-term benefits, keeping in mind that the cost of a cyber incident can far surpass the investment in effective security measures.

Fostering a culture of cyber security awareness among employees is crucial for London-based organizations to protect themselves against the ever-evolving threat landscape. Here are some effective strategies to achieve this:

  1. Implement regular training programs: Conduct engaging, interactive training sessions that cover the latest cyber threats and best practices. Consider using gamification techniques to make learning more enjoyable and memorable.
  2. Leverage local expertise: Partner with London-based cyber security firms or invite experts from institutions like the National Cyber Security Centre (NCSC) to provide workshops and seminars.
  3. Develop a clear cyber security policy: Create and communicate a comprehensive policy that outlines expectations, procedures, and consequences related to cyber security practices.
  4. Lead by example: Ensure that leadership and management teams actively demonstrate good cyber security habits and openly discuss the importance of security measures.
  5. Conduct simulated phishing exercises: Regularly test employees with simulated phishing emails to gauge awareness levels and provide immediate feedback and education.
  6. Implement a reward system: Recognize and reward employees who consistently demonstrate good cyber security practices or report potential threats.
  7. Utilize internal communication channels: Share regular updates, tips, and news about cyber security through company newsletters, intranets, or dedicated Slack channels.
  8. Tailor training to specific roles: Provide role-specific cyber security training, as different positions may face unique threats (e.g., finance team vs. customer service).
  9. Encourage reporting: Create an easy-to-use system for employees to report suspicious activities or potential security breaches without fear of reprimand.
  10. Integrate security into onboarding: Make cyber security awareness a key part of the onboarding process for new employees, setting the tone from day one.

By implementing these strategies, London-based organizations can significantly improve their cyber security posture. According to a 2022 UK government report, 39% of UK businesses identified a cyber attack in the previous 12 months, with this figure rising to 69% for large businesses. This underscores the importance of fostering a strong security culture.

Remember, creating a culture of cyber security awareness is an ongoing process that requires consistent effort and adaptation to new threats. By making it a priority and involving all levels of the organization, London businesses can better protect themselves against cyber threats and contribute to the city's reputation as a secure hub for business and innovation.



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) have become integral components of modern cyber security solutions in London, revolutionizing how businesses protect their digital assets. These technologies are increasingly crucial in the face of evolving cyber threats and the growing complexity of IT infrastructures.

Key roles of AI and ML in cyber security:

  1. Threat Detection and Prevention: A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data in real-time, identifying patterns and anomalies that may indicate potential cyber threats. This allows for faster and more accurate detection of both known and unknown threats.
  2. Automated Response: ML-powered systems can automatically respond to identified threats, reducing response times and minimizing potential damage. This is particularly crucial in London's fast-paced business environment, where every second counts in cyber incident response.
  3. Predictive Analysis: By analyzing historical data and current trends, AI can predict future attack vectors and vulnerabilities, allowing organizations to proactively strengthen their defenses.
  4. Behavioral Analysis: ML algorithms can learn normal user and system behaviors, making it easier to spot suspicious activities that deviate from the norm.
  5. Fraud Detection: In London's financial district, AI-driven fraud detection systems are particularly valuable, helping to identify and prevent sophisticated financial crimes.

London-specific applications:

In London's diverse business landscape, AI and ML are being tailored to meet specific industry needs:

  • Financial Services: Advanced AI models are employed to detect complex financial fraud schemes and ensure compliance with stringent regulatory requirements.
  • Tech Startups: AI-powered security solutions are helping London's burgeoning tech scene protect their intellectual property and sensitive customer data.
  • Government and Public Sector: ML algorithms are assisting in safeguarding critical infrastructure and sensitive government data against state-sponsored cyber attacks.

Statistical Insight: According to a recent survey by TechUK, 78% of cyber security firms in London are now incorporating AI and ML into their solutions, a 15% increase from the previous year.

While AI and ML offer significant advantages, it's important to note that they are not silver bullets. Human expertise remains crucial in interpreting results, making strategic decisions, and addressing complex, nuanced cyber security challenges. London's cyber security professionals are increasingly focusing on developing skills that complement AI and ML technologies, ensuring a holistic approach to cyber defense.

As London continues to be a prime target for cyber attacks due to its status as a global financial and business hub, the role of AI and ML in cyber security is expected to grow even further. Organizations in the city are advised to stay informed about these technological advancements and consider integrating AI and ML-powered solutions into their cyber security strategies to stay ahead of evolving threats.



The cyber security landscape in London is rapidly evolving, with emerging technologies playing a crucial role in shaping its future. As one of the world's leading financial and technology hubs, London is at the forefront of adopting innovative cyber security solutions. Here are some key emerging technologies and their implementations:

  1.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ML):
    • London-based companies are leveraging AI and ML to enhance threat detection and response capabilities.
    • Predictive analytics are being used to identify potential vulnerabilities before they can be exploited.
    • Many financial institutions in the City are implementing AI-powered fraud detection systems.
  2. Quantum Computing and Quantum-Resistant Cryptography:
    • With the UK's significant investments in quantum research, London is preparing for the quantum era in cyber security.
    • Financial services firms are exploring quantum-resistant algorithms to protect sensitive data against future quantum attacks.
    • The National Cyber Security Centre (NCSC) in London is actively working on post-quantum cryptography standards.
  3. Zero Trust Architecture:
    • London's businesses, especially those with remote workforces, are adopting zero trust models.
    • This approach assumes no trust by default, requiring continuous verification for all users, devices, and applications.
    • Implementation includes multi-factor authentication, micro-segmentation, and least-privilege access controls.
  4. Internet of Things (IoT) Security:
    • With London's smart city initiatives, securing IoT devices is becoming increasingly important.
    • Companies are implementing IoT security platforms to manage and protect connected devices across the city.
    • Edge computing is being used to process data closer to IoT devices, reducing exposure to network-based attacks.
  5. Blockchain and Distributed Ledger Technology (DLT):
    • London's fintech sector is leveraging blockchain for secure, transparent transactions.
    • DLT is being explored for identity management and supply chain security in various industries.
    • The technology is also being used to create immutable audit trails, enhancing accountability and reducing fraud.

Implementation of these technologies in London often involves:

  • Collaboration between tech startups, established companies, and academic institutions like Imperial College London and UCL.
  • Support from government initiatives such as the London Office for Rapid Cybersecurity Advancement (LORCA).
  • Integration with existing security frameworks to ensure compliance with UK and EU regulations, including GDPR.
  • Continuous training and upskilling of the cyber security workforce to keep pace with technological advancements.

As cyber threats continue to evolve, London's cyber security ecosystem is adapting by embracing these emerging technologies. The city's unique position as a global financial centre and tech hub drives innovation in cyber security, making it a leader in implementing cutting-edge solutions to protect digital assets and infrastructure.
